Final H1N1 Vaccine Clinic at Cooper for Current Flu Season on February 25th

February 15, 2010 Leave a Comment
The final H1N1 vaccine clinic for Cooper patients and employees will be held on Thursday, February 25, 2010 from 6 – 8:30 p.m. at Three Cooper Plaza, Suite 400, Camden, NJ. This will be your last opportunity to receive the vaccine at Cooper during the current flu season. Both the nasal vaccine (Flumist) and the injectable vaccine will be provided at these clinics subject to vaccine availability.

Camden County Department of Health and Cooper University Hospital to Provide H1N1 Shots to Children

November 9, 2009 Leave a Comment
The Camden County Department of Health and Human Services and Cooper University Hospital will be hosting an H1N1 vaccination clinic for children ages 6 months to 5 years as well as children ages 6 years – 18 years with underlying medical conditions. The H1N1 vaccine will be the injectable vaccine, which is not thimerosal-free.

H1N1 Flu Shots to be Given to Priority Groups in Burlington County Over Three Fridays in November

October 21, 2009 Leave a Comment
The Burlington County Health Department in Westampton will hold H1N1 flu shot clinics to vaccinate priority groups on three consecutive Fridays from 2 p.m. to 4 p.m. on November 6, 13 and 20, 2009 at their offices (15 Pioneer Boulevard, Westampton, New Jersey 08060).
